原文:Kafka集群中一台broker挂掉的处理过程

controller在启动时会注册zk监听器来监听zookeeper中的 brokers ids节点下的子节点变化,即集群中所有的broker列表,而每台broker在启动时会向zk的 brokers ids下写入一个名字为broker.id的临时节点,当该broker挂掉或与zk断开连接时,此临时节点会被移除,之后controller端的监听器就会自动感知这个变化并将BrokerChange时间 ...

2021-01-29 09:24 0 557 推荐指数:

查看详情

假如Kafka集群中一broker宕机无法恢复,应该如何处理

假如Kafka集群中一broker宕机无法恢复, 应该如何处理? 今天面试时遇到这个问题, 网上资料说添加新的broker, 是不会自动同步旧数据的. 笨办法 环境介绍 三个broker集群, zk,kafka装在一起 创建测试topic 查看 注意当前 ...

Sat Aug 03 23:19:00 CST 2019 0 666
kafka集群broker频繁挂掉问题解决方案

现象:kafka集群频繁挂掉 排查日志:查看日志文件【kafkaServer.out】,发现错误日志: ERROR Shutdown broker because all log dirs in /tmp/kafka-logs have failed ...

Thu Apr 11 19:08:00 CST 2019 0 3429
kafka集群broker频繁挂掉问题解决方案

现象:kafka集群频繁挂掉 排查日志:查看日志文件【kafkaServer.out】,发现错误日志:ERROR Shutdown broker because all log dirs in /tmp/kafka-logs have failed ...

Tue Oct 29 00:48:00 CST 2019 0 430
kafka一个broker挂掉无法写入

Kafka日志: broker 133 received LeaderAndIsrRequest with correlation id 1 from controller 132 epoch 35 fro partition [__consumer_offsets,13] but cannot ...

Tue Sep 10 23:01:00 CST 2019 0 1035
搭建Kafka集群(3-broker

Apache Kafka是一个分布式消息发布订阅系统,而Kafka环境往往是在集群中配置的。本篇就对配置3个brokerKafka集群进行介绍。 Zookeeper集群 Kafka本身提供了启动了zookeeper的脚本和配置文件。 1. 修改配置文件 进入kafka主目录,编辑文件 ...

Sun Oct 09 23:49:00 CST 2016 0 5255
mysql的连接处理过程

  在mysqld_main函数中经过一系列的初始化后,mysql开始监听客户端的连接 查看mysqld_socket_acceptor:   这是一个类模版Connection_acce ...

Fri Mar 30 22:51:00 CST 2018 0 1239
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M